Job Description

Title:
Laundry Room Attendant Reports to:
Director of Residential Life Schedule/Travel:
Part-time, academic year position.
Schedule is:
Monday, 11 a.m.-4 p.m., Wednesday, 11 a.m.-6 p.m., and Friday, 11 a.m.-6 p.m.
FLSA:
Non-exempt Classification:
Staff Position Summary:
Responsible for maintaining the Laundry Room while providing services to support the Kent School community.
Specific Duties and Responsibilities include:
Physically work out of the Laundry Room to distribute clean laundry bags and/or clean dry cleaning to students. Ensure the individual room within the Laundry Room remains organized. Log issues/complaints by students in a Google Sheet shared with the Dean's Office.
Qualifications:
Current member of the Kent School community (ideally) Strong organizational and communication skills
Additional Requirements:
Successful completion of post-offer, pre-employment criminal background checks and drug test. Maintain punctual and regular attendance. Work is performed on a smoke-free campus.
